Send us a text In this very special episode, we have the great and wonderful, Annie Leal. Annie thrived in the business world by inventing a very popular alternative to chamoy into a very successful Sugar-free version called I Love Chamoy. Through many hurdles and things to overcome, Annie has proved that we can accomplish any and all dreams. She was featured on Shark Tank and become the most viral product sold in recent years on social media and online.
